This aircraft had the ability of caring two 1600lb bombs in a internal weapons bay and two more on strong point under the wing or a pair of 2000lb torpedoes under the wing six 50 cal. machine gun in the wing or 20 mm cannons. It was powered by XR4360-10 Wasp Major with a contra-rotating propeller.
